In a heartwarming display of friendship and nostalgia, a woman from Kansas has taken the concept of re-wearing bridesmaid dresses to a whole new level. Many of us have heard the phrase, “You can definitely wear this dress again!” during wedding planning. However, most bridesmaids likely rolled their eyes at the thought. Yet, one Oklahoma mom and children’s book author, named Lisa Greene, has shown that it’s entirely possible to rock a bridesmaid dress—even if it’s been tucked away for two decades.

On the anniversary of her wedding, Greene shared a throwback photo from her big day, captioning it with a playful nod to the bridesmaid dresses worn by her friends: “These two 22-year-olds are celebrating 22 years of marriage! Hubba-hubba. (Sorry about those dresses, ladies.)” While friends flooded the comments with standard anniversary wishes, one former bridesmaid decided to step up the game.

Her friend, Julia Harper, promptly responded with a cheeky, “Sorry about the dresses? I wear mine all the time!” She then shared a series of entertaining photos showing herself in the burgundy dress while doing everyday activities like laundry, watering plants, and lounging with a book. Talk about being bridesmaid fabulous!

Harper shared with Modern Family Blog, “Lisa and I don’t see each other often, but we always have a good laugh over each other’s Facebook posts. We’re even plotting an author visit to local schools in the Kansas City area. I think a reading of ‘Mary Had A Little Glam’ in Lisa’s wedding gown would be a perfect fit!”

Greene mentioned to Buzzfeed News, “Not everyone in 1995 wanted a long, off-the-shoulder gown in a burgundy brocade that resembled a Thanksgiving tablecloth.” She noted that those dresses were crafted by moms, grandmas, and various seamstresses, giving them a unique charm.

Nostalgia can certainly stir up some laughs when we look back at past fashion choices. Greene’s wedding gown choice perfectly encapsulated the early ’90s, and we’re thrilled that at least one of her friends cherishes that dress for its quirky beauty.

Harper also revealed that her mom kept all her bridesmaid dresses from yesteryears. “Over time, I’ve been known to randomly don one of those dresses and join whatever family activity is happening, acting like it’s completely normal to be in a bridesmaid dress,” she shared.

Greene’s reaction to Harper’s photos? “This right here is the best anniversary present ever!”
